Investigation Summary
An employee was working at an assisted living facility for the elderly. She was taking care of patients both at their homes and inside a skilled nursing facility where infected patients were being treated. On March 22 and March 29, 2020, she provided home health services to a client in the client's private residence. On March 18, March 19, and March 20, 2020, she worked in a skilled nursing facility operated by her employer. She did not have a medical evaluation for an N95 respirator. At some point, she was exposed to COVID-19. It was not clear whether she was hospitalized. She died at 8:00 a.m. on April 12, 2020. This was an OSHA-covered fatality. An investigation found that the employer's workers were exposed to exacerbation of pre-existing cardio pulmonary conditions. The safety and health inspector learned through employee interviews and a review of documents that the employer did not have a provision or procedures for medical evaluation in the written respiratory program. The employer provided and mandated employees to wear N95 Respirator when working with COVID-19 positive patients.
